Hey all, does anyone know the procedure for swapping to Ironman headlamps. I am thinking about doing this to my 06 limited and wanted to first know how complicated this really was. Also does anyone know the current rates on the parts?

Yeah those look good...I have a black limited and think that it would look so cool on it. Any idea how hard it is to install?
 












It was very easy..just two screws, pop the original headlights out like you were going to change the bulb, and swap the new ones in. It is a direct replacement. Did it in under 30 mins..
 






Don't forget the third bolt at the bottom. :)
